アプリケーションの説明

この2Dプラットフォーマーは、ゾンビを殺し、キーを見つけ、ゲートを逃がすように挑戦します。ゾンビと戦い、広大で迷路のようなレベルでゴールデンキーを探します。死はやり直すことを意味するので、注意を払ってください!

特徴には、クールな武器、健康ポーション、そして発見する隠された領域が含まれます。レベルは複雑な迷路として設計されており、キーを見つけるための手がかりに注意深い調査と注意が必要です。ゾンビの大群を通り抜けて出口に到達します。

重要な機能:

  • 素晴らしい音楽とサウンドエフェクト!
  • ロボット、ゾンビ、そしてより詳細なアニメーション!
  • 積極的にあなたを排除しようとしているインテリジェントな敵! -8レベル(もうすぐ来ます!)

あなたの戦略を選択してください:ゾンビを殺すか、それらを回避しますが、あなたは生き残ることができますか?
